多任务操作系统的工作机制:如何高效管理并行任务

时间:2025-12-07 分类:操作系统

多任务操作系统在现代计算中扮演着至关重要的角色,尤其是在处理多个应用程序和服务时。这类系统通过并行处理技术,将多个任务分派给不同的处理器或处理核心,有效提升了计算效率和资源利用率。理解多任务操作系统的工作机制,可以帮助开发者和用户在选择、优化和管理系统时做出明智的决策。

多任务操作系统的工作机制:如何高效管理并行任务

在当前市场上,多任务操作系统的主流有Windows、macOS、Linux等,每种系统的实现方式和效率各有特点。性能评测显示,Linux通常在服务器环境中表现出色,而Windows和macOS在用户体验和图形界面操作上更具优势。这种差异使得各种用途的选择成为关键,包括办公应用、开发环境和高性能计算。

另一方面,随着信息技术的不断发展,DIY组装个人计算机已经成为了一种趋势。合理的硬件选择不仅能提升性能,还能最大化利用多任务操作系统的优势。尤其是在处理多媒体内容和高强度计算任务时,选择合适的CPU、内存和SSD将直接影响到系统的性能。例如,推荐配置高主频的多核处理器及更大的RAM,以便处理复杂的并行任务。

性能优化是应用多任务操作系统的另一重要方面。系统中的各个服务和应用之间的调度机制,对获取最佳性能至关重要。通过掌握线程管理、资源分配及内存优化等技术,可以有效减少资源冲突和响应时间。许多现代操作系统都具备动态负载均衡的功能,能够根据系统当前的负载状况智能调整任务的分配策略,从而实现高效的任务管理。

当面临多任务操作系统的实际应用时,用户很容易遇到一些常见问题。了解这些问题及对应的解决方法,将有助于提升使用体验。

常见问题解答

1. 多任务操作系统是什么?

多任务操作系统能够同时管理多个运行中的程序,并有效分配处理器时间和资源。

2. 我应该选择哪个多任务操作系统?

选择操作系统应考虑个人需求,例如Windows适合一般办公和娱乐,Linux则适合服务器和开发。

3. DIY组装计算机时,硬件配置有何建议?

建议选择多核处理器、大容量RAM和高速SSD,以支持多任务操作的高效运行。

4. 如何优化多任务操作系统的性能?

可以通过更新驱动程序、清理系统垃圾和管理启动项来优化性能,同时确保系统及时更新。

5. 多任务处理能否提升游戏性能?

是的,现代操作系统通过优化多核心处理可以提升游戏及应用的响应速度,减小延迟。

通过深入了解多任务操作系统的工作机制和基本操作,用户和开发者不仅能够提升计算效率,还能够更好地享受数字时代带来的便利。